Hi all,
A friend with a VW Beetle, 51 plate (so from 2001) has an intermittent
problem. Sometimes a yellow lights comes on her dashboard – it has a
triangle with a circular arrow round it, and when this happens the car
tends to judder – but not all the time.

I`ve attached a full code read below. Any suggestions? I initially
thought it was possibly the brake pedal switch that`s a common fault on
VW`s, but doesn`t look likely from the code read.

Thanks in advance for your help.
